Days Inn By Wyndham Fort Wright Cincinnati Area
39.056607, -84.544663Overview
The 2-star Days Inn By Wyndham Fort Wright Cincinnati Area, located 3.1 km from Goebels Park, offers an outdoor pool and Wi-Fi throughout the property. The inn is a good starting point to Fort Wright's sports attractions, including the outdoor football Paul Brown Stadium, which is 10 minutes away by car.
Location
The centre of Fort Wright can be reached in 15 minutes' walk of the property, and such cultural venues as Cincinnati Museum Center are 6 km away. Bloomington is 6 km from the Days Inn By Wyndham Fort Wright Cincinnati Area Fort Wright, while Smale Riverfront Park is approximately a 10-minute ride away. A family vacation to Fort Wright will become more exciting if you visit Newport Aquarium lying within a 6-km distance of the accommodation.
For those travelling from afar, Cincinnati/Northern Kentucky International airport is 18 minutes' drive away.
Rooms
Some of the 30 air-conditioned rooms at the Days Inn By Wyndham Fort Wright Cincinnati Area are furnished with a sofa, and appointed with a coffee maker. Guests can also use a bathtub and a shower, along with such amenities as free toiletries and bath sheets. You can enjoy views of the pool.

missingWrote a review on 09 Septgreat locationfriendly staffcomfortable roompoor breakfastlack of cleanlinessbroken air conditioner
The location near the Reds Stadium really stood out for me. It made getting to the game easy. The room size worked well for my family. We had a Queen Room with Two Queen Beds, Non-Smoking. The beds felt decent enough but could use a little more fluff. I liked that housekeepers were honest and returned a necklace I left behind. That gave me some comfort that things would be taken care of. Unfortunately, the breakfast options didn't impress. There were only waffles and some basic cereals. The milk wasn't cold enough, and there seemed to be a shortage of fruit. I also noticed the air conditioner wasn't functioning as well as it should. Some areas of the hotel felt run-down, like the hallway. A fresh coat of paint would go a long way. I think they could step things up in cleanliness too. I found some dirt in my room that should have been cleaned up. It's a shame because the staff tried their best. It seemed like they're making changes, but the place needs more attention to detail.
